Basic Web Design

($65 + $2 fee)
Basic Web Page Design is intended to be an introduction for anyone who may be considering a personal, nonprofit, or business website. Its primary focus is how to find a reputable hosting company and how to upload, submit, and revise content and graphics. Students will learn to design and construct a basic website using a personal domain name. Free design software and FTP software will be used and no knowledge of code is necessary. Templates will be provided for an easy start. Students must provide their own flash memory drive, which will be used in class and at home. Emphasis will be placed on links, images, page content, and layout. Once the class is completed, students will feel comfortable migrating to a paid hosting site and using professional software programs like WordPress, Dreamweaver, or Expression Web to further improve their websites. Students will also learn how websites are found on search engines such as Google, Bing, and Yahoo. Web Design & Development

($120)
This course is designed to provide an understanding of how to enhance the development and performance of website design and to begin building dynamic, interactive, data-driven Web applications with powerful capabilities. Course topics can include, but are not limited to, understanding Web markup language, effective use of Portable Web Documents, creating and enforcing a uniform and consistent look for an entire website, creating attractive page layouts with tables and related topics, using leading Web application platform(s) for developing interactive websites, and related topics.

WordPress for Entrepreneurs

($65 + $2 supply fee)
This course is designed to help those who already have a WordPress website. The focus will be primarily how to edit and manage content including posts and forms. Students will learn how to add useful widgets, improve images, revise content, manage posts and optimize their site for search engines.
